jsp中的注释有:
1、HTML的注释<!-- -->
用于注释html代码
2、jsp注释<%-- --%>
用于注释jsp中的java代码,EL表达式,jstl标签或者其他标签
3、script脚本语言注释// 和 /* */
用于注释javascript等脚本语言
需要注意的是:
HTML注释在浏览器查看源代码时是可见的;如果使用HTML的注释来注释含有java代码或者表达式的语句,例如:“<!-- ${123+1 } -->”;那么程序在运行时不会忽视html代码注释的内容,EL表达式里面的语句仍然会执行,jstl的判断语句也会执行,如果使用HTML注释了的表达式标签出现了语法错误也会导致程序报错,所以HTML注释中的内容也不能一律忽视,出现问题时也要查看HTML注释中的内容。
同样的道理,在js中使用单行注释//或者多行注释/**/来注释了EL表达式或者标签语言,同样还是会执行注释中的内容的